Working Principles

The TDA8574T/N1,518 operates on the principle of amplifying audio signals using internal circuitry. It takes in an input audio signal and amplifies it to a higher power level suitable for driving speakers or other audio output devices. The IC ensures low distortion and noise levels, resulting in high-quality audio reproduction.

  1. What is the maximum supply voltage for TDA8574T/N1,518?
    - The maximum supply voltage for TDA8574T/N1,518 is 18V.

  2. What is the typical output power of TDA8574T/N1,518?
    - The typical output power of TDA8574T/N1,518 is 4 x 40W.

  3. Can TDA8574T/N1,518 be used in automotive audio systems?
    - Yes, TDA8574T/N1,518 is suitable for automotive audio systems.

  4. What is the recommended operating temperature range for TDA8574T/N1,518?
    - The recommended operating temperature range for TDA8574T/N1,518 is -40°C to 105°C.

  5. Does TDA8574T/N1,518 require external heat sinking?
    - Yes, TDA8574T/N1,518 requires external heat sinking for proper thermal management.

  6. Is TDA8574T/N1,518 compatible with digital input signals?
    - No, TDA8574T/N1,518 is designed for analog input signals.

  7. Can TDA8574T/N1,518 be used in bridge-tied load (BTL) configurations?
    - Yes, TDA8574T/N1,518 can be used in bridge-tied load configurations.

  8. What is the total harmonic distortion (THD) of TDA8574T/N1,518 at full output power?
    - The THD of TDA8574T/N1,518 at full output power is typically 0.5%.

  9. Does TDA8574T/N1,518 have built-in short-circuit protection?
    - Yes, TDA8574T/N1,518 features built-in short-circuit protection.
